Women ought to search for a light-weight sundress for daytime, or seo a protracted elegant costume that feels beachy for an evening wedding. The extra upscale you wish to look, the fancier the fabric should be with easy cotton being the most informal and satin and shiny materials being the dressiest. Fluid, floaty kinds work best, however be careful of too much quantity as flying materials in coastal winds can require plenty of administr
n.
Chiffon appears shimmery within the light, giving off a more elegant contact to a wedding dress. When paired with an A-line silhouette, chiffon creates the ultimate flowy and free-spirited wedding ceremony costume fashion. On the opposite hand, tulle is more matte in appearance and is slightly stiffer. This material is ideal for brides looking for their princess-worthy second as they walk down the aisle along the sun-drenched seaside. In recent years, straps and sleeves have come back in an enormous means for the fashionable bride, and for good reason—they have loads of opportunity for innovation. Simple wedding ceremony clothes are good for the bride-to-be who appreciates clean strains, streamlined silhouettes, and classic fabrics. Since everyone's definition of easy is not necessarily the same, there are many several sorts of wedding ceremony clothes that fall into this class. If you're a bride with minimalist tastes, you must look for pared-back slip dresses or fashionable silhouettes crafted from unador
cloth.
We're swooning over this minimalist crepe fit-to-flare wedding dress. The delicate embroidered cape sleeves steadiness out the robe's plain fitted silhouette. Plus, the sheer tulle back adds a tad of romance to this elegant robe. Just because you're a minimalist bride does not imply your only possibility is a completely plain robe.
